Sep. 2006 – Sep.2007
Promet, Calgary, AB
Meteorological Field Service
Field air monitoring for local gas company well sites, including SO2 and H2S sensors,
extensive SCADA and data acquisition, remote setup by way of helicopter. Designed and
managed Projects, like the Remote Monitoring System, I built and designed 15 units for
Promet. Including Campbells Scientific Data Loggers, powered by solar Batteries and
Panels, several connections for H2S and SO2 inputs, wind head mechanism to measure
wind speed and direction with built in compass, several TC temperature inputs for inside
and out of units. Meteorlogical towers also used onsite for 100 ft clearance of wind head,
real time controls and alarming used. Once SO2 was detected at remote station on
mountain, the data logger would shut down well from emitting anymore SO2 at flare
stack. Otherwise it will flare, I maintained and built these systems which we could have
many out at one time on separate gas wells all over Alberta and BC.

Mar/ 2001 – Jun/ 2003
General Electric, Schenectady, NY.
Gas Turbine Instrumentation specialist GE
I was a Senior Test Specialist for GEPS tuning Gas Turbines for many Peaker Plants all
over the world. I completed commissioning on site at many plants, once built the unit
was tested based on power output, fuel consumption, stability on temperature, and
Emissions etc.., I used instrumentation on site to measure and record temperatures
throughout unit as well as power output and gas flow with Rosemount transmitters. We
also had CO2, NOX, and Oxygen Analyzers on the exhaust stack which we would
calibrate before hand with proper calibration gases. We frequently tested steam turbines
on site as well as part of heat recovery transferred to more power output. I used a portable
gas chromatograph for analyzing Natural gas composition while in the field as part of
final performance test of Gas Turbines for GE. High Voltage Generator Measurements
using metering PT’s and CT’s for GEPS.
June 27-Dec. 8/2000
NF Hydro, Holyrood, NF.
Instrumentation Technologist
Several of the Thermal power plant duties involved regular shutdown Preventative
Maintenance during summer and service while in operation during the winter. I held a
contract position as instrumentation tech. maintaining systems from water treatment plant
to the boiler controls and instrumentation, to all instrumentation on the steam turbines,
many processes required maintenance. I overhauled many control valves and actuators,
and the control loops involved, once valves were returned it was necessary to calibrate
the loop with all transmitters and the control system in the control room. all types of
processes serviced from level controls using sonar, radar, pressure, capacitance probes
and floats to controls for fuel and atomizing air for boiler guns. Emission controls to limit
SO2, also Environmental Monitoring of water treatment plant, Ph values, Sulfur Dioxide,
Oxygen levels in exhaust gases and Sodium levels in boiler water for NF. Hydro.
